    Raising kids is not that ******* hard. How about this...

    1. Belonging
    2. Power
    3. Freedom
    4. Fun

    Those are the 4 basic psychological needs of not only your children, but also yourself.

    Everyone needs to feel like they belong to something. For most of us that is several things, family, friend group, videohelp, professional, etc. The issue with kids is when they begin to feel less belonging to family and more belonging to friends.

    Everyone needs to feel like they have some kind of power. Like they do something very well, or something they do that they are proud of. This is a big loser in our high school or at least in my 165 kids, with is sad. They don't feel like they don't do anything very well. Which leads to apathy. Which leads to low self-esteem, which leads to "lower" social groupings, which leads to drugs and could lead to suicide.

    Everyone needs to have some feeling of freedom. Even if it is just freedom of choice. To feel like they personally can make some decisions.

    Everyone wants to have fun. When things are fun, we enjoy doing them, and will inevitably do them better.
